Beehive Forum is a free and open-source forum system using the PHP scripting language and MySQL database software.. The main difference between Beehive and most other forum software is its frame-based interface which lists discussion titles on the left and displays their contents on the right.

Beekeeping in India has been mentioned in ancient Vedas and Buddhist scriptures. Rock paintings of Mesolithic era found in Madhya Pradesh depict honey collection activities. Scientific methods of beekeeping , however, started only in the late 19th century, although records of taming honeybees and using in warfare are seen in the early 19th century.

Another hive design was invented by Rev. John Thorley in 1744; the hive was placed in a bell jar that was screwed onto a wicker basket. The bees were free to move from the basket to the jar, and honey was produced and stored in the jar. The hive was designed to keep the bees from swarming as much as they would have in other hive designs. [33]
